In today's digital landscape, businesses have more options than ever when it comes to creating an online presence. Website builders like Wix, Squarespace, and WordPress offer pre-made templates and drag-and-drop interfaces that make website creation accessible to everyone. However, while these tools are convenient, they come with limitations that can hinder the performance, scalability, and uniqueness of your website. For businesses looking to stand out and create a highly optimized, scalable, and unique web application, custom development using frameworks like Next.js is the superior choice.
Next.js, a popular React framework, is designed for building fast and scalable web applications. One of its core features is server-side rendering (SSR), which pre-renders pages on the server rather than on the client side. This leads to faster load times, especially for dynamic content, and better SEO performance. Website builders, on the other hand, often rely on client-side rendering, which can result in slower initial load times, particularly for content-heavy sites.
Next.js also supports static site generation (SSG), which allows you to generate HTML at build time, further improving load times and reducing server load. This combination of SSR and SSG in Next.js ensures that your website not only loads faster but also handles traffic spikes more efficiently.
Search engine optimization (SEO) is crucial for businesses looking to improve their online visibility. Next.js enhances SEO through its ability to render content on the server side, allowing search engines to crawl and index pages more effectively. Additionally, Next.js provides fine-grained control over metadata, URL structures, and page optimization, all of which are essential for a strong SEO strategy.
In contrast, many website builders lack advanced SEO features and may not offer the same level of control over how content is rendered or indexed by search engines. While some website builders offer basic SEO tools, they often fall short when it comes to optimizing complex, content-rich websites.
One of the primary advantages of using Next.js is the ability to create completely custom websites that align with your specific business needs and branding. Next.js allows developers to build unique user interfaces, integrate with various APIs, and create custom functionalities that are tailored to your business goals.
Website builders, while user-friendly, come with predefined templates and limited customization options. This can lead to generic-looking websites that may not fully align with your brand identity. Additionally, the lack of flexibility in website builders can be a significant drawback if your business requires specific features or integrations that are not supported by the platform.
As your business grows, your website needs to scale with it. Next.js is designed to handle the demands of scaling, from managing increased traffic to integrating with complex backend systems. With Next.js, you can build web applications that are not only scalable but also maintainable over time.
Website builders, however, may struggle with scalability. They are often built on shared hosting environments, which can lead to performance bottlenecks as your site traffic increases. Additionally, the rigid structure of website builders can make it difficult to implement new features or redesign your site as your business evolves.
Security is a top priority for any business, especially when handling sensitive customer data. Next.js allows for a more secure web development process, as you have full control over the codebase and can implement best practices for securing your application.
Website builders, while generally secure, offer limited control over security features. You are dependent on the platform's security measures, and any vulnerabilities in the platform could potentially affect your website. Custom development with Next.js allows you to take proactive steps to protect your site from security threats.
While website builders offer lower upfront costs, they often come with recurring subscription fees and limited functionality. As your business grows and requires more advanced features, these costs can add up, and you may find yourself paying for additional plugins or services to fill in the gaps.
With Next.js, the initial investment in custom development may be higher, but it offers long-term cost efficiency. You own the codebase, which means you can make updates and changes without being tied to a specific platform. Over time, this can lead to significant cost savings, especially as your website grows and evolves.
Custom development using Next.js offers a powerful, flexible, and scalable solution for businesses that want to create a truly unique and optimized online presence. While website builders like Wix and Squarespace provide convenience, they come with significant limitations that can impact your website's performance, SEO, security, and ability to scale.
For businesses serious about their digital strategy and long-term success, investing in custom development with Next.js is the smarter choice. At Excalibur Interactive, LLC, we specialize in crafting tailored web applications that meet your specific needs and help you stand out in a competitive landscape. If you're ready to elevate your online presence and explore the full potential of custom web development, we invite you to reach out to our team. Let's work together to create a solution that empowers your business to thrive.